Hestra Touch Point Fleece Liner Jr. - 5 Finger

"The Touch Point Fleece Liner Jr. - 5 Finger by Hestra is the ideal companion for active children who like to be out and about. This soft and comfortable children's glove made of stretchy polyester fleece is not only comfortable to wear, but also particularly functional. Thanks to the touchscreen-compatible coating on the thumb and index finger, children can easily operate their mobile devices without having to take off their gloves."
"Perfect for activities such as hiking and ski touring, the glove offers a secure fit thanks to the elasticated wrist. On cold or rainy days, it can also be worn underneath a pull-on glove to provide additional protection. A practical puller on the cuff makes it easy to put on and take off, while the machine washability ensures easy care."
